Date: Sat, 2 Jun 2007 13:13:31 GMT From: Max Brazhnikov<makc@issp.ac.ru> To: freebsd-gnats-submit@FreeBSD.org Subject: ports/113255: maintainer update: math/qtiplot and dependencies (part 4) Message-ID: <200706021313.l52DDVeb081047@www.freebsd.org> Resent-Message-ID: <200706021320.l52DK4fZ097052@freefall.freebsd.org>
next in thread | raw e-mail | index | archive | help
>Number: 113255 >Category: ports >Synopsis: maintainer update: math/qtiplot and dependencies (part 4) >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: maintainer-update >Submitter-Id: current-users >Arrival-Date: Sat Jun 02 13:20:04 GMT 2007 >Closed-Date: >Last-Modified: >Originator: Max Brazhnikov >Release: FreeBSD 6.2-STABLE i386 >Organization: >Environment: FreeBSD luna.dio.ru 6.2-STABLE FreeBSD 6.2-STABLE #1: Sun Apr 29 09:40:21 MSD 2007 root@luna:/usr/obj/usr/src/sys/LUNA i386 >Description: Update QtiPlot to 0.9-rc2. Changes: Migrate from Qt 3 to Qt 4.2. Added support for antialiasing. It is now possible to plot only a partial row range of a data column. More symbols for text labels. Improved printing and export of 2D plots to PDF, EPS and PS. Full import of Origin 7.5 project files. Lots of bug fixes and improvements. ----------------------------------------- Update liborigin to 20070529. Changes: Full support of 7.5 projects. Support Origins's standdalone file formats: *.ogw (worksheet) and *.ogm (matrix). ----------------------------------------- New port qwtplot3d-qt4-0.2.6 - qt4 version of qwtplot3d. ----------------------------------------- Switch qwt-devel from qt3 to qt4. >How-To-Repeat: >Fix: Patch attached with submission follows: # This is a shell archive. Save it in a file, remove anything before # this line, and then unpack it by entering "sh file". Note, it may # create directories; files and directories will be owned by you and # have default permissions. # # This archive contains: # # qwtplot3d-qt4 # qwtplot3d-qt4/pkg-descr # qwtplot3d-qt4/Makefile # qwtplot3d-qt4/pkg-plist # qwtplot3d-qt4/distinfo # qwtplot3d-qt4/files # qwtplot3d-qt4/files/patch-qwtplot3d.pro # echo c - qwtplot3d-qt4 mkdir -p qwtplot3d-qt4 > /dev/null 2>&1 echo x - qwtplot3d-qt4/pkg-descr sed 's/^X//' >qwtplot3d-qt4/pkg-descr << 'END-of-qwtplot3d-qt4/pkg-descr' XThis is a Qt4 version of QwtPlot3d - a feature-rich Qt/OpenGL-based XC++ programming library, providing essentially a bunch of 3D-widgets. X XWWW: http://qwtplot3d.sourceforge.net/ END-of-qwtplot3d-qt4/pkg-descr echo x - qwtplot3d-qt4/Makefile sed 's/^X//' >qwtplot3d-qt4/Makefile << 'END-of-qwtplot3d-qt4/Makefile' X# New ports collection makefile for: qwtplot3d-qt4 X# Date created: 2007-05-27 X# Whom: Max Brazhnikov <makc@issp.ac.ru> X# X# $FreeBSD$ X# X XPORTNAME= qwtplot3d XPORTVERSION= 0.2.6 XCATEGORIES= math XMASTER_SITES= SF X#MASTER_SITE_SUBDIR= X#PKGNAMEPREFIX= XPKGNAMESUFFIX= -qt4 X#DISTNAME= XEXTRACT_SUFX= .tgz X#DISTFILES= X#DIST_SUBDIR= ${PORTNAME} X#EXTRACT_ONLY= X XMAINTAINER= makc@issp.ac.ru XCOMMENT= A 3D plotting widgets for scientific data and math expressions X XUSE_QT_VER= 4 XQT_COMPONENTS= gui moc qmake opengl XUSE_LDCONFIG= yes XHAS_CONFIGURE= yes X XWRKSRC= ${WRKDIR}/${PORTNAME} X Xdo-configure: X cd ${WRKSRC} && ${SETENV} ${CONFIGURE_ENV} \ X ${QMAKE} -unix PREFIX=${PREFIX} ${PORTNAME}.pro X Xpre-build: X cd ${WRKSRC} && ${REINPLACE_CMD} -e \ X 's|^CC .*|CC=${CC}|; \ X s|^CXX .*|CXX=${CXX}|; \ X s|^LINK .*|LINK=${CXX}|; \ X s|-pipe||; \ X s|^\(CFLAGS .*= \)|\1${CFLAGS}|; \ X s|^\(CXXFLAGS = \)|\1${CXXFLAGS}|; \ X /^INCPATH/s|-I\.|-Iinclude|;' Makefile X Xdo-install: X (cd ${WRKSRC}/include/ && ${COPYTREE_SHARE} \* ${PREFIX}/include/qwtplot3d-qt4) X ${INSTALL_PROGRAM} ${WRKSRC}/lib/libqwtplot3d-qt4.so.${PORTVERSION} ${PREFIX}/lib X ${LN} -fs ${PREFIX}/lib/libqwtplot3d-qt4.so.${PORTVERSION} ${PREFIX}/lib/libqwtplot3d-qt4.so.0 X ${LN} -fs ${PREFIX}/lib/libqwtplot3d-qt4.so.${PORTVERSION} ${PREFIX}/lib/libqwtplot3d-qt4.so X X.include <bsd.port.mk> END-of-qwtplot3d-qt4/Makefile echo x - qwtplot3d-qt4/pkg-plist sed 's/^X//' >qwtplot3d-qt4/pkg-plist << 'END-of-qwtplot3d-qt4/pkg-plist' Xinclude/qwtplot3d-qt4/qwt3d_autoptr.h Xinclude/qwtplot3d-qt4/qwt3d_autoscaler.h Xinclude/qwtplot3d-qt4/qwt3d_axis.h Xinclude/qwtplot3d-qt4/qwt3d_color.h Xinclude/qwtplot3d-qt4/qwt3d_colorlegend.h Xinclude/qwtplot3d-qt4/qwt3d_coordsys.h Xinclude/qwtplot3d-qt4/qwt3d_drawable.h Xinclude/qwtplot3d-qt4/qwt3d_enrichment.h Xinclude/qwtplot3d-qt4/qwt3d_enrichment_std.h Xinclude/qwtplot3d-qt4/qwt3d_function.h Xinclude/qwtplot3d-qt4/qwt3d_global.h Xinclude/qwtplot3d-qt4/qwt3d_graphplot.h Xinclude/qwtplot3d-qt4/qwt3d_gridmapping.h Xinclude/qwtplot3d-qt4/qwt3d_helper.h Xinclude/qwtplot3d-qt4/qwt3d_io.h Xinclude/qwtplot3d-qt4/qwt3d_io_gl2ps.h Xinclude/qwtplot3d-qt4/qwt3d_io_reader.h Xinclude/qwtplot3d-qt4/qwt3d_label.h Xinclude/qwtplot3d-qt4/qwt3d_mapping.h Xinclude/qwtplot3d-qt4/qwt3d_multiplot.h Xinclude/qwtplot3d-qt4/qwt3d_openglhelper.h Xinclude/qwtplot3d-qt4/qwt3d_parametricsurface.h Xinclude/qwtplot3d-qt4/qwt3d_plot.h Xinclude/qwtplot3d-qt4/qwt3d_portability.h Xinclude/qwtplot3d-qt4/qwt3d_scale.h Xinclude/qwtplot3d-qt4/qwt3d_surfaceplot.h Xinclude/qwtplot3d-qt4/qwt3d_types.h Xinclude/qwtplot3d-qt4/qwt3d_volumeplot.h Xlib/libqwtplot3d-qt4.so Xlib/libqwtplot3d-qt4.so.0 Xlib/libqwtplot3d-qt4.so.0.2.6 X@dirrm include/qwtplot3d-qt4 END-of-qwtplot3d-qt4/pkg-plist echo x - qwtplot3d-qt4/distinfo sed 's/^X//' >qwtplot3d-qt4/distinfo << 'END-of-qwtplot3d-qt4/distinfo' XMD5 (qwtplot3d-0.2.6.tgz) = 7ef960d7874f78162d6c9d241de2843e XSHA256 (qwtplot3d-0.2.6.tgz) = ea7c2ea3d55960ee60019e0a5a5a63385bdcf7026a6385099fd8b31350803125 XSIZE (qwtplot3d-0.2.6.tgz) = 148834 END-of-qwtplot3d-qt4/distinfo echo c - qwtplot3d-qt4/files mkdir -p qwtplot3d-qt4/files > /dev/null 2>&1 echo x - qwtplot3d-qt4/files/patch-qwtplot3d.pro sed 's/^X//' >qwtplot3d-qt4/files/patch-qwtplot3d.pro << 'END-of-qwtplot3d-qt4/files/patch-qwtplot3d.pro' X--- ./qwtplot3d.pro.orig Thu Jul 21 21:00:46 2005 X+++ ./qwtplot3d.pro Sun May 27 21:11:49 2007 X@@ -2,7 +2,7 @@ X # X X X-TARGET = qwtplot3d X+TARGET = qwtplot3d-qt4 X TEMPLATE = lib X CONFIG += qt warn_on opengl thread zlib X MOC_DIR = tmp END-of-qwtplot3d-qt4/files/patch-qwtplot3d.pro exit >Release-Note: >Audit-Trail: >Unformatted:
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200706021313.l52DDVeb081047>